英文摘要
Human gait motion analysis including trans-femoral amputee with the prosthetic limb was performed in the adaptable cases to various terrain conditions such as level, slant and stairs reflecting activities of daily living. Next, In addition to load condition, angular variation and energy consumption in each joint of the lower limb, quantitative gait evaluation indices that mean contributing rate of intersegmental coordination based on singular value decomposition were defined by elucidating phenomena from kinematic and kinetic perspectives. As a result of these applications to intercomparison of health subjects and trans-femoral amputee, unrestrained gait motion analysis technique with broad utility was developed.Moreover, left and right translational disturbances were separately input to the human limb including trans-femoral amputee. Finally, gait training technique with objective indices for gait disability person was developed by considering interaction with each evaluation indices.
